Now without further ado I will get to the meat and veg of this blog which is to discuss "AVP".

"AVP" stands for Andy On, Vanness Wu and Philip Ng, the three actors attached to star as we haven't been able to come up with a decent title we can all agree on.

The film will be a gritty modern action film in the Heroic Bloodshed tradition featuring gunfights and martial arts. I have written the script and will direct, with Mike Leeder as producer and Philip Ng as action coordinator.

At this years Filmart the project was officially announced to be the first project produced under the auspices of Mike Leeder's new company "Silent Partners" as part of the "Triumphant Film Fund" which is currently coming together with the intention of producing an ongoing slate of movies that will work for both Eastern and Western audiences.

If we were willing to completely sell out and make a generic action movie that might hit the mark in certain areas, we could have probably secured full funding by now, but the major force behind the AVP project has been to make the movie that we want to make, one that would showcase myself as a director, Phil's skill as an action choreographer, and give Vanness, Andy & Phil roles that would stretch them both in the acting and action departments.

 

We developed this project for a core team that is myself, Mike as producer, Andy, Vanness and Phil and we want to retain the control of the project to do it the right way, without selling out or compromising ourselves.

 

 

There has been a lot of projects that started with good intentions that were then heavily compromised when the first offers of money came in, and then the finished project wasn't a fraction of what was intended.

 

Call us idealistic, but we know what we want to do, and it might take a little longer to lock down full funding while retaining full control, but we all believe in the project.
